In Pittsburgh, Allegheny Health Network’s West Penn Hospital is commemorating the birth of new babies as well as the 25th anniversary of Toy Story with the SWEETEST themed outfits for newborns!

Toy Story Land Entrance

Some of the babies born at the West Penn Hospital recently were dressed in hand-woven Buzz, Woody, and Jessie outfits that might be the cutest things we’ve ever seen. According to WESH 2 News, West Penn Hospital has stated that “We hope that their dreams will take them to infinity and beyond, and they’ll always have a friend in us.”
